Truck Driver – Class A
Job Description
Department: Myrl & Roy’s
Reports to: Trucking Manager
Effective Date: 1/7/2025
Job Summary:
The primary function of a Class A Truck Driver is to safely operate a Class A commercial vehicle. A Truck Driver transports and delivers aggregate products, asphalt, concrete, and heavy equipment to our construction crews and local area customers accurately and timely while providing excellent customer service.
Supervisory Responsibilities:
Does not have any direct reports.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
• Drive and operate a commercial vehicle safely.
• Follow GPS instructions and road maps.
• Complete and document pre- and post-trip inspections per DOT regulations.
• Responsible for basic vehicle maintenance; comply with all safe work practices, policies, and processes at all times.
• Complete and verify paperwork for accuracy.
• Reports needed repairs to the Trucking Manager.
• Follow all established company safety requirements.
• Follow on-site directions from customers or construction crews for delivery.
• Must be able to back up for long distances.
• Willingness to work in a team environment and assist co-workers or supervisors with other duties as required.
Required Skills/Abilities:
• Possess and maintain a valid Class A driver’s license.
• Must be registered with the Clearinghouse.
• Pass a background check, drug screen, and driving history check.
• CDL medical card (medical examiner’s certificate(MEC)) preferred, but not required.
• Be able to work variable hours which may include overtime.
• Excellent communication/interpersonal skills.
• Excellent problem-solving skills.
• Keen attention to detail.
• Good work attendance is a must.
• Ability to work safely in a team environment.
Education and Experience:
• High School diploma or GED
Physical Requirements:
• Ability to sit and drive for long durations.
• Ability to climb stairs and ladders.
• Ability to tolerate working outdoors in all environmental temperatures and weather conditions.
• Ability to walk on uneven surfaces.
• Must be able to lift up to 50 pounds at times.
